How Common Is The Last Name Ashbir? popularity and diffusion
This last name is the 601,907th most widespread last name globally It is held by around 1 in 14,123,151 people. It is mostly found in Asia, where 99 percent of Ashbir live; 98 percent live in West Asia and 96 percent live in Levant. It is also the 998,282nd most widely held first name worldwide It is held by 91 people.
The surname Ashbir is most frequently occurring in Palestine, where it is borne by 470 people, or 1 in 9,678. In Palestine Ashbir is most common in: Gaza Governorate, where 47 percent live, Khan Yunis Governorate, where 23 percent live and North Gaza Governorate, where 20 percent live. Other than Palestine it occurs in 10 countries. It is also common in Iraq, where 5 percent live and Yemen, where 2 percent live.
